Worth a look:
http://audisrs.com/about46765.html&highlight= The spec of the original Avus design alloy wheel for the S8 is 8x18 ET48 The very similar wheel from the S4 is the same size but ET45 which if I remember my wheel offset info means it sticks out 3mm more than the original S8 wheel - not a problem by any means and many people stick spacers on that push them out a lot further than that! Just widens the search options a bit as there's a heck of a lot more S4s being scrapped than S8s |
